Old Time Democrats Rally Behind Collins at Beaumont Speech

The Beaumont State convention heard Senator W. A. Collins defend states rights and constitutional limits in face of the New Deal. He warned against eroding the Bill of Rights and cautioned Texans to stay true to state sovereignty while supporting federal relief without losing state identity. The crowd praised his stance and urged Texans to uphold the old Democratic standard.

What Makes One a Good Citizen

An essay questions what tests determine American citizenship and argues the oath to bear arms is too narrow a standard. It notes past court rulings bar individuals like Quaker Herbert Hoover, while suggesting civilians can serve nation in war through noncombat roles. The piece cites Lafitte as a counterexample and calls for a broader qualification beyond killing.

Dallas Faces Three Large Federal Housing Plans

The Dallas Times-Herald notes three large low cost housing projects are under consideration for Dallas funded largely by the federal government. The piece argues that such projects rarely deliver truly low cost homes and urges readers to compare with government settlements and resettlement lands in nearby states to gauge true costs.

Freight rate study urged to help Texas farmers and industries

Texas members of Congress push a special study of freight rates to aid farmers and diverse industries. Representative Fritz Lanham cites discriminatory rates that favor outsiders and hinder Texas exports and growth, urging changes in the rate structure to improve transport and competitiveness. Marvin Jones advocates examining freight costs tied to Texas cultural products and cotton, noting high overheads in railways and transport hubs.
